CoroMill Plura New Small Ball Nose End Mills

This is a new range of small CoroMill Plura ball nose end mills for profiling applications in medium hard to hard steels, 35-72 HRc. Small diameters down to 0.1 mm (0.004 inch) make them suitable for all small die and mold manufacturing where high precision is important.

Application

  • Die and mould; manufacturing of small, often plastic, mouldings, forging and casting dies
  • Electronic components
  • Medical tooth implants
  • Hardened steels (35–72 HRc)

Technical features

  • Fine-grained solid carbide grade, GC1700, with multi-layered PVD coating having high hardness and high wear resistance
  • Geometry design prevents radius from deteriorating from uneven wear
  • Edge preparation for improved wear behaviour
  • Neck, an advantage in pocket milling
  • High accuracy:
    • +0.003 / -0.007 mm
    • (+0.0001 / -0.0003 inch)
